Output 980457c7806c6ee17023cf0ff67361dc71b57a1ab86e2c4569844a310e89fec8:23

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e75029c7c8a31de05ba8c659e1f983e6545c021682b7e452a23130a940ae58fd
address
bc1puagzn37g5vw7qkagcev7r7vrue29cqsks2m7g54zxyc2js9wtr7sd34dx6
transaction
980457c7806c6ee17023cf0ff67361dc71b57a1ab86e2c4569844a310e89fec8
confirmations
7414
spent
true